Job Overview
Pharmacy associates focus on the needs of our customers as they entrust us with their prescriptions and health needs. They are responsible for providing customer service in our store pharmacies.
Benefits & perks
At Walmart, we offer competitive pay as well as performance-based incentive awards and other great benefits for a happier mind, body, and wallet. Health benefits include medical, vision and dental coverage. Financial benefits include 401(k), stock purchase and company-paid life insurance. Paid time off benefits include parental leave, family care leave, bereavement, jury duty, and voting. Other benefits include short-term and long-term disability, company discounts, Military Leave Pay, adoption and surrogacy expense reimbursement, and more.
You will also receive PTO and/or PPTO that can be used for vacation, sick leave, holidays, or other purposes. The amount you receive depends on your job classification and length of employment. It will meet or exceed the requirements of paid sick leave laws, where applicable. For information about PTO, see Smart Guide page
Live Better U is a Walmart-paid education benefit program for full-time and part-time associates in Walmart and Sam's Club facilities.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or's deg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are completely paid for by Walmart.
Eligibility requirements apply to some benefits and may depend on your job classification and length of employment. Benefits are subject to change and may be subject to a specific plan or program terms. For information about benefits and eligibility, see One.Walmart.com.

The Sales Merchandiser position is responsible for the execution of Anderson Merchandisers standards to drive sales and meet retailer and client expectations This position is under the supervision of the Market Sales Manager but daily communication and follow-up with the Territory Sales Lead is expected.What would you do in this role?
DUTIES and RESPONSIBILITIES, include but are not limited to the following:
- Build rapport through daily communication with store associates and management
- Educate customers and store personnel on the features and benefits of our client’s brands and product lines
- Execute all required tasks, projects, resets, displays with accuracy, by following all provided instructions
- Maintain accuracy and high quality of work to meet or exceed client expectations
- Merchandising and execution of all assigned projects with required quality and accuracy to maintain account aesthetics and consistently deliver above average project execution compliance
- Have detailed knowledge of all company policies
- Communicate to the Territory Sales Lead on a daily basis as to all activities accomplished as well as any sales opportunities and make Territory Sales Lead and Market Sales Manager aware of success or potential barriers reporting specific requests, needs, and sales opportunities
- Knowledgeable, detailed understanding and consistent use of all available functions of handheld device
- Maintain company, client and retailer confidentiality
REQUIREMENTS AND QUALIFICATIONS, including but not limited to the following:
- Must be able to lift objects and product up to a maximum of 50 lbs with frequent lifting and/or carrying of objects/products up to 35 lbs., in addition the ability to lift heavy objects up to 100 lbs with assistance from another associate
- Work could be performed while sitting, standing or walking
- Work performed will entail fine manipulation of hands and/or fingers, bending, twisting, squatting, and climbing, as well as upper and lower body mobility
- Must be able to work a flexible schedule, including nights, overnights and weekends
- High School diploma or equivalency certification required
- Valid driver's license is required as travel to additional locations may be necessary
- Automobile liability insurance is required to be maintained
- Must have access to a computer, internet access, printing capabilities, and e-mail
- Customer service or sales experience preferred
